For over 50 years, Associated Pediatricians has been providing exceptional care for families with children from birth to 21 years old. Located in Northwest Indiana, we have offices in Valparaiso and Portage. We offer convenient hours including Saturdays, as well as appointments within 24 hours for sick children. Our group of Board Certified pediatricians is on staff at Northwest Health Hospital in Valparaiso. We also have affiliations with Lurie Children's Hospital in Chicago and Riley Children's Hospital in Indianapolis.

The germs continue to spread out there this winter....spring....winter....whatever season it decides to be today! 🤣
Our nurses are receiving A LOT of calls about kids with stomach flu! The stomach flu tends to start with vomiting and then often progresses to a stage with diarrhea. Sometimes a fever will accompany the illness, other times it is just vomiting. The most important thing with stomach flu is to keep your child hydrated, which for most kids means a minimum of 2-3 urine outputs in 24 hours. If you're worried your child is dehydrated, call us so we can help guide you!

Also out there right now is the actual flu, in this case, influenza B. Influenza B includes fevers, cough, congestion, and sometimes some GI symptoms including diarrhea and or vomiting. LOTS of kids with influenza B are complaining of leg pain this year and a small number of kids have progressed to having actual muscle breakdown, a condition called rhabdomyolysis. While muscle aches can be normal with influenza, these aches shouldn't be so bad that your child can't walk, If the pain is that bad, we'll want to see them in the office to evaluate and make sure nothing else is going on.

In addition to influenza B, there are a lot of kids with just a general viral respiratory illness that looks like influenza, but the swabs are coming back negative. Kids with this have been having nasal congestion, cough, and some have had fevers, others have not.

With all this fever talk, it's probably good to remind you that you can find the dosing for fever medications on our website. Acetaminophen can be used in infants and children ages 2 months and up (only with permission from the doctor should it be used younger than this) and ibuprofen can be used for children ages 6 months and up. Does your child struggle to calm down and fall asleep at night? Do all the worries of the day seem to come out at bedtime? Or maybe you have a wiggly kid who just can't calm their body down enough to rest? If you're ready to ditch the bedtime hassle and have a calmer, gentler bedtime, then this awesome workshop from our Behavioral Health Consultants is for you! Kids ages 6-12 years old can join our BHCs for a fun sleepy skills event! Send your child in their comfiest PJs with a stuffed animal, small blanket, and small pillow, and they will learn some great skills to help them calm their bodies and minds for bedtime. Parents can participate in the full event or just join us at the end for a half-hour session to learn all about the skills their children have learned. This event is FREE and open to the public (your child does not have to be a patient at Associated Pediatricians), but registration is required.
